Vladimir Dmitriev is a scholar working on Materials Chemistry, Geophysics and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Vladimir Dmitriev has authored 201 papers receiving a total of 5.9k indexed citations (citations by other indexed papers that have themselves been cited), including 138 papers in Materials Chemistry, 74 papers in Geophysics and 50 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Vladimir Dmitriev's work include High-pressure geophysics and materials (74 papers), X-ray Diffraction in Crystallography (36 papers) and Crystal Structures and Properties (25 papers). Vladimir Dmitriev is often cited by papers focused on High-pressure geophysics and materials (74 papers), X-ray Diffraction in Crystallography (36 papers) and Crystal Structures and Properties (25 papers). Vladimir Dmitriev collaborates with scholars based in France, Russia and Germany. Vladimir Dmitriev's co-authors include Dmitry Chernyshov, P. Tolédano, Leonid Dubrovinsky, Yaroslav Filinchuk, Natalia Dubrovinskaia, Vadim Dyadkin, H.‐P. Weber, Philip Pattison, Alexandr V. Talyzin and Tamás Szabó and has published in prestigious journals such as Nature, Journal of the American Chemical Society and Physical Review Letters.
